How to Make a Sleigh Out of Popsicle Sticks

Materials Needed

  • Popsicle sticks (regular or jumbo size)
  • Craft glue or hot glue gun
  • A pair of scissors
  • Paint (optional)
  • Paint brushes (optional)
  • Embellishments (e.g., ribbon, mini bells, faux fur, beads, etc.)
  • Clear Lacquer or Sealant (Optional)

Step-by-step instructions

Planning Your Design

Before diving into the building process, take a moment to visualize your ideal sled design. Think about the size, shape, and overall aesthetic you want to achieve. You can choose to replicate a classic sleigh or let your imagination run wild with unique variations.

Build the base

Start by building the base of the sleigh. Lay two popsicle sticks parallel to each other, leaving a small gap between them. Apply a thin line of craft glue or use a hot glue gun to attach a third popsicle stick horizontally across the two parallel sticks. This will form the base of your sled.

Construct the sides

Take two popsicle sticks and measure and cut them to the length of the base. Attach these sticks vertically to the ends of the base to form the sides of the sled. Use glue to hold them in place. Make sure the sides are lined up and perpendicular to the base.

Add the sleigh runners

To make the sleigh runners, cut two popsicle sticks to the desired length. These sticks should be longer than the base so that they extend outward and curve upward like the runners of a sleigh. Glue them to the bottom of the base, one on each side. Make sure they are evenly aligned and have a gentle curve.

Reinforce the structure

Place additional popsicle sticks horizontally across the sides of the sled to reinforce the structure and add stability. Glue them in place at regular intervals, making sure they are parallel to the base.

Finishing Touches

Once the basic structure is complete, let your creativity take over. Paint the sled in your favorite colors using acrylic or craft paint. You can also add embellishments such as ribbon, mini bells, faux fur trim, or beads to enhance the sleigh’s appearance. Allow the paint and glue to dry completely before proceeding.

Optional Varnish or Sealant

To protect your masterpiece and give it a polished finish, consider applying a clear varnish or sealant. This step will help preserve the colors and materials used. Follow the instructions provided with the varnish or sealant product for best results.

Experiment with different popsicle stick sizes

While regular-sized popsicle sticks are commonly used for crafting, don’t be afraid to explore jumbo-size sticks or even mini-sticks for your sleigh. Different sizes can add variety and uniqueness to your design.

Personalize with paint and patterns

Get creative with paint by adding patterns, stripes, or intricate designs to your sleigh. Use multiple colors or create a gradient effect for a visually stunning display. Consider using metallic or glitter paint for a touch of sparkle.

Add details and accessories



Take your sleigh to the next level by adding small details and accessories. Add tiny bows, miniature gifts, or even a faux wreath to the front of the sleigh. You can also add small figurines, such as miniature reindeer or Santa Claus, to complete the festive scene.

Explore different finishing techniques

Instead of traditional painting, try other finishing techniques like decoupage or wood staining to give your sleigh a unique look. Decoupage allows you to adhere decorative paper or fabric to the surface, while wood staining can give the popsicle sticks a rich and polished look.

Create a sleigh display

Build a complete holiday scene by creating a popsicle stick sleigh along with other complementary elements. Consider making miniature trees, a snowy landscape, or even a tiny gingerbread house to go with your sleigh. Display them together on a mantle, as a centerpiece, or as part of a holiday-themed diorama.

Incorporate lights



Add a touch of magic to your sleigh by incorporating small LED lights or string lights. Carefully weave them through the structure of the sleigh or place battery-powered lights inside the sleigh for a warm and inviting glow.

Share the fun

Making a popsicle stick sleigh can be a wonderful activity to enjoy with family or friends. Get everyone involved, gather different supplies and decorations, and let everyone’s creativity shine. It’s a fun way to bond and create lasting memories.

Add a seat or sleigh bells

Consider using extra popsicle sticks to create a small seat or bench inside the sleigh. This can give your sleigh a more realistic and detailed look. You can also add small sleigh bells to the sides or front of the sleigh for a fun jingling sound.

Create a scene

Use cardboard or foam board to create a scenic backdrop for your sleigh. Paint a winter scene or cut out snowflakes and attach them to the backdrop. This will add depth and context to your sleigh and make it the centerpiece of a larger holiday display.

Go vintage



If you’re going for a nostalgic or vintage look, distress the popsicle sticks with sandpaper or use a technique called “dry brushing” to create a weathered look. This can give your sleigh an antique charm.

Add faux snow

Add a touch of winter wonderland by applying a layer of faux snow to the bottom and runners of your sleigh. You can use cotton wool, white glitter, or even fake snow spray to achieve the desired effect.

Build a matching sled

Expand your craft project by making a matching sled to go with your sleigh. Use similar techniques and materials, but adjust the size and design to make it different from the sleigh. This allows you to create a cohesive set for display.

Personalize with monograms or names

For a personal touch, consider adding monograms or names to the sides of the sleigh. You can use adhesive letters, paint stencils, or even write them by hand with a fine-tipped brush.

Create a miniature gift display

Turn your sleigh into a festive gift display by placing tiny wrapped gifts or gift boxes inside. You can make them out of colored paper, ribbon, or even repurpose small jewelry boxes.

Display with lights

Highlight your popsicle stick sled by placing it in front of a backdrop of twinkling lights. String fairy lights or Christmas lights behind and around the sled to create a magical glow.

What kind of popsicle sticks should I use to make a sled?

You can use either regular-size or jumbo-size popsicle sticks, depending on the desired size of your sled. Regular-size sticks are readily available and work well for smaller sleds, while jumbo-size sticks can be used for larger or more elaborate designs.

What kind of glue should I use to assemble the popsicle stick sled?

Craft glue or a hot glue gun are both good options for assembling your popsicle sleigh. Craft glue provides a strong bond and is easy to work with. A hot glue gun provides a quick and secure bond, but requires caution due to the high temperature of the glue.

Can I paint my popsicle sleigh?

Yes, painting your popsicle stick sleigh can add a vibrant and personal touch to your creation. Acrylic or craft paint works well for this purpose. Before painting, make sure the glue is completely dry and consider lightly sanding the sticks to create a smoother surface for the paint to adhere to.
